    Ok, my 53 customline still runs stock rear end, this was a flat v8 and is now a mild built 302 w/c4. At 70mph its turning 4000 and pumping too much oil thats making a mess. Any ideas what would be a good donor for a new rear end?

    Send a PM to Fireball350. He just put a new rearend in his 53 cusomline. I believe that it was a ford 8" out of a Mustang, cant remember the year tho. It was an inch or so narrower. Fits great, dropped his RPM a decent ammount.

  4. I used a early mustang. Pads are in the right spot and the bolt pattern on the axel flange is the same so I just used the 53 brakes and ebrake cables rather than try to make the Mustang stuff work

    I have a '70 Mach 1 9" in mine, fits but it could use a little more room. I've heard that the Maverick ones are a good fit, either way you retain the correct bolt pattern. 57-59 Ford smooth back 9" rears are also a popular choice.
